Over the years Ive met other dental cabinet owners who are missing a knob (replaceable) or a milk glass top (I tell them to fabricate a replacement by using opaque acrylic Plexiglas).
Ive also met owners who wish they could replace their broken cabinet-door/window pane, but you just cant. The pattern stopped being produced about 75 years ago.
